Output 256499312e3a03aabdb426bb2a94d1bb57a1f52844ca5d0d9dd85aa6bf64a71f:6

value
465676
script pubkey
OP_0 OP_PUSHBYTES_20 8f0c8e732ed5fa620c0065d4d4db2acdff155458
address
bc1q3uxguuew6haxyrqqvh2dfke2ehl324zc7rumqa
transaction
256499312e3a03aabdb426bb2a94d1bb57a1f52844ca5d0d9dd85aa6bf64a71f
confirmations
210592
spent
true